Hey there. Have an odd occurrence. Upgrade to v20 latest from v18. That was smooth and went great. Have a Yealink W70B Dect Base with 1 handheld. When the phone comes up in the 3cx console it shows 2 Phones with same MAC and extension. Under Phones tab is where it shows the phone twice. So what is happening a call comes in. Only 2 phones at the site. When call is picked up from handheld when ringing it is dead air when it is an external call. Internal direct call to it works fine. I ran a capture and I see 2 separate Invites being sent to it at the same time. Only 2 phones are in the ring group. PCAP shows the 1 deskphone invite fine, but I see 2 to the handheld extension. I am suspecting this is what is causing the issue. Another site with same W70B and latest firmware does not have the issue and shows up fine in Phones (only 1 listed). Wondering if anyone has seen this and what is best next steps. To note, only 2 phones at the site so SBC was not really looked at. Thanks in advance.

Hi there. Yes, was setup as STUN. I have read thru the suggested setup with a router phone and can configure one if needed. Few questions on the different approaches:

1) Can I pre-setup the router phone from another location/different network, then take it to site, plug-in, and then re-config the base station to connect thru it? Or should the router phone and base station all be configured/added while onsite?

2) If the one site has a working desk phone thru STUN and we put the router phone there as well with the yealink base station connecting thru it, will the existing desk phone keep working or will I need to reconfig that one as well? I know in end all should go thru the router phone, but initially wondering if the existing desk phone will have any issues?

3) In interim until can get the router phone setup, if STUN, I see we should assign local sip sig port on the yealink base to another port like 5065 (tcp/udp) and rtp ports 14000-14011 (udp). Assign a static ip to the base station. Then Port forward to these ports. On the phone/user in 3cx admin would we have to add these ports to the 3cx side config? Or are these local ports just on the yealink side?

In end since only 2 phones here (desk phone and w70b) eventually will have router phone with the handheld. But seeing what can do in interim until can get the router phone setup and others connecting thru it.

Thanks in advance for the assistance.
 
1) Yes but only configure the W70 after the phone is up and running at the final site (3CX needs to learn its final IP and tell it to the W70).

2) The existing STUN phone is not affected by this. However, it can still fail independently regardless (due to STUN being used).

3) We no longer support STUN so there is no option to set the port anymore


In the interim there isn't much you can do, STUN will either work or it won't unfortunately..
Make sure to factory reset and reprovision fresh when swapping from STUN to SBC mode.

This worked perfect. I ended up redoing all 3 phones. Setup router phone, static ip the router phone. Plug that in on-site. Factory reset w70B, re-add that to 3cx via router phone, and then redid the front desk phone T48S after factory reset and updating latest firmware. I see what it does where it proxies thru the router phone. Works great. Real easy to add and configure everything. Thanks again for your recommendation/assistance. Now don't have to worry about STUN.
